MYSTAYS Rebrands Two Hotels as Kamenoi Hotels

MYSTAYS Hotel Management will rebrand two of its hotels as “Kamenoi Hotel” in April.

On April 1st, Katsuura Gyoen will be renamed to “Kamenoi Hotel Nachikatsuura”, and on April 23rd, Tsukubasan Onsen Tsukuba Grand Hotel will change its name to “Kamenoi Hotel Tsukubasan”.

At “Kamenoi Hotel Nachikatsuura”, the lobby lounge and restaurant will be renovated, and the rooms, which were previously predominantly Japanese-style, will be partially renovated into Western-style rooms with beds, considering international guests. “Kamenoi Hotel Tsukubasan” will feature a new open-air bath, and renovations will also be made to the restaurant and guest rooms. Both are scheduled to be completed in July.

Kamenoi Hotel is a hotel brand operating in 37 facilities across 24 hot springs locations nationwide, including 30 facilities of “Kanpo no Yado” taken over and started operating in April 2022. This rebranding will increase the total to 39 facilities.
